Djupdalen Camping by the Klarälven river
Published: 3/5/2026 • By CampApp

Djupdalen Camping is located just outside the village of Ekshärad in northern Värmland. This small nature campsite sits along the banks of the Klarälven River and offers a peaceful setting surrounded by forests and water. With only a limited number of camping spots close to the river, the atmosphere remains calm and personal, making it a good choice for visitors who want to slow down and enjoy nature.
The Klarälven River is a central part of the experience. Its wide and gentle waters provide good opportunities for both fishing and canoeing. Many visitors enjoy exploring the river at a relaxed pace while taking in the surrounding landscape. For those who prefer to explore on land, there are several hiking trails in the area. Forest paths lead through berry fields and varied woodland where wildlife and birdlife are often present.
The campsite also offers open spaces where children can play and move freely. There is a playground and an indoor playroom available. In the evenings many guests gather around the barbecue area or the campfire where the day often ends beneath a clear sky filled with stars.
Nearby attractions
The nearby village of Ekshärad is known for its historic wooden church. The church is especially famous for its wrought iron grave crosses dating back to the seventeenth century, a tradition that still exists in the area.
Visitors who want to explore more of the surrounding nature can visit Brattfallet. Here the water falls into a deep ravine and the site becomes especially impressive after rainfall. Another option is the Halgaleden hiking trail which passes through forests and open landscapes and offers several scenic viewpoints.
